Roman River Festival 2008
last updated : Wed 24th Sep 08



The Roman River Festival is a festival of French music, food, film and culture to celebrate the 100th anniversary of the birth of the composer Olivier Messiaen. The event takes place from Thursday 9th until Sunday 12th October 2008 at various locations in the coastal region of north-east Essex.

The festival has invited some of the foremost chamber musicians of their generation to play the dramatic and haunting Quartet for the End of Time in an award-winning local theatre. The festival's song recital will be given in the candlelit surroundings of Fingringhoe Church by the soprano Katerina Mina.

The festival will also feature a Louis Malle film and morning concerts in East Mersea and Abberton churches. Zoe Rahman will showcase her new jazz world fusion album Where rivers meet. The talented young viol player Liam Byrne will perform the rich and expressive music of Marin Marais.

The programme of events is as follows:
FILM
7.30pm Thursday 9 October, Fingringhoe village hall - Milou en Mai Louis Malle

LAKESIDE CONCERT
7.30pm Friday 10 October, Lakeside Theatre, University of Essex - Simon Blendis violin Kate Gould cello; Duncan Prescott clarinet Simon Crawford-Phillips piano; Debussy Rhapsody Chopin Polonaise; Franck Sonata for violin and piano Messiaen Quartet for the End of Time.

BACH AT ABBERTON CHURCH
11am Saturday 11th October, St Andrew's Church, Abberton - Juliet Jopling viola; Bach Suite in C major, arr viola.

CANDLELIT CONCERT
7.30pm Saturday 11 October, St Andrew's Church, Fingringhoe - Katerina Mina soprano Simon Crawford-Phillips piano; Saint-Saëns, Chausson, Bizet & Schumann.

MARIN MARAIS AT EAST MERSEA CHURCH
11am Sunday 12 October, St Edmund, King and Martyr, East Mersea - Liam Byrne and Caroline Ritchie viols; Marin Marais.

ZOE RAHMAN - JAZZ CONCERT & SUPPER
Sunday 7 October, Fingringhoe Village Hall - Zoe Rahman piano Idris Rahman clarinet.

Tickets
Tickets for those aged 30 and under are priced at £3 per concert with a free glass of wine. A festival pass gives a discount of 20% on all the concerts, and a 'foursome' gives a further 5% discount on four passes. For more information please telephone 01206 729 356.

Roman River Festival takes place in various villages in a beautiful coastal region of north-east Essex, with local wine and beer, smoked fish and wild scenery. There are a choice of B&Bs and places to eat in the area. The area is a few minutes drive from Colchester, within two hours drive of London and Cambridge and within an hours drive of Ipswich.
